Transaction efbc2c0452dfca832cb2d7be45cf3d34304797fb77bec35114bce3867a170ec7

1 Input
1 Outputs
  • efbc2c0452dfca832cb2d7be45cf3d34304797fb77bec35114bce3867a170ec7:0
  • value  699986731
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G